Ingredients

Let’s gather our ingredients! Here’s what you’ll need to whip up your very own Easy Fruit Pizza:

  • 1 cup brown sugar: This adds a nice depth of flavor and serves as a natural sweetener for your crust. You can substitute with coconut sugar for a lower glycemic option.

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our: This is your basic building block for the cookie crust. If you’re looking for a gluten-free alternative, try almond flour or a gluten-free flour blend.

  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ened: Butter gives your cookie base richness and moisture. If you’re vegan, feel free to swap in coconut oil or vegan butter.

  • 1/2 teaspoon baking powder: This gives the crust a little lift, ensuring it’s nice and light. Baking soda can work in a pinch if you’re out of baking powder.

  • 1/4 teaspoon salt: Just a pinch to balance out the sweetness! Don’t skip this; it enhances all the flavors.

  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ract: A dash of vanilla elevates the whole experience. If you want to shake it up, switch to almond extract for a different flavor twist.

  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ened: This creamy base is a must for that rich topping. For a lighter version, use Greek yogurt or whipped mascarpone.

  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ar: This sweetens the cream cheese layer perfectly. For a hassle-free alternative, use agave syrup or honey.

  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ract (again): You’ll use this in your cream cheese layer, because double the vanilla means double the yum!

  • Assorted fresh fruits: Think strawberries, kiwis, blueberries, bananas—the sky’s the limit! Pick seasonal fruits for the best flavors.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Now that we have our ingredients ready let’s get into the nitty-gritty of creating this fabulous fruit pizza!

  1. Prepare the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This will ensure your crust starts baking as soon as you’re ready to put it in.

  2. Mix the Dry Ingredients: In a m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, brown sugar, baking powder, and salt until well combined. This step is crucial as it ensures that your dry ingredients are evenly distributed, leading to an expertly baked crust.

  3. Cream the Butter: In a separate bowl, beat the softened butter until it’s light and fluffy—about 2-3 minutes. This is where the magic happens! Creaming the butter helps trap air, resulting in a lighter crust.

  4. Combine & Blend: Gradually add your dry mixture to the creamed butter, mixing until just combined. Be careful not to overmix, as this can lead to a tough crust. It’s okay if a few lumps remain!

  5. Shape the Crust: Spread the dough onto a greased pizza pan or a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. You can use your hands or a spatula to shape it into a circle about ½ inch thick. Make it pretty; the crust is the canvas for your delicious fruit art!

  6. Bake: Pop the crust into the preheated oven and bake for 12-15 minutes or until it turns lightly golden. Keep an eye on it to prevent it from browning too much. It should be set, but still soft!

  7. Cool Down: Once baked, remove it from the oven and allow it to cool completely. Be patient here—spreading the cream cheese layer on a hot crust will only lead to a melty disaster!

  8. Prepare the Cream Cheese Layer: In a medium bowl, beat together the softened cream cheese, powdered sugar, and vanilla extract until smooth. This frosting-like topping will be the glue that holds your fruit in place.

  9. Spread it Out: Once cooled, spread the cream cheese mixture evenly over the cooled crust. Don’t be shy; this is where the real flavor comes from!

  10. Load Up on Fruit: Time to get creative! Slice your assorted fruits and arrange them on top of the cream cheese layer. Feel free to get artistic—this is your personalized culinary masterpiece!

  11. Chill (Optional): If you’re not serving right away, I recommend refrigerating your fruit pizza for about 30 minutes. This will help everything set and meld together beautifully.

  12. Slice & Serve: Cut into wedges or squares, and serve immediately. Watch those smiles pop up as everyone takes their first bite!

Recipe Variations

Now, if you’re feeling adventurous, here are a few creative twists you can try:

  1. Nutty Base: Add some crushed nuts or oats to the crust mixture for an extra crunch!

  2. Chocolate Drizzle: Melt some dark chocolate and drizzle it over the fruit for a decadent touch.

  3. Tropical Escape: Swap the fruits for tropical varieties like mango, pineapple, and coconut for a sunny vibe.

  4. Berry Blast: Double down on the berries—blueberries, raspberries, and blackberries for a berry lover’s dream!

  5. Spiced Cream Cheese: Mix in a little cinnamon or nutmeg into your cream cheese blend for a warm flavor twist!

FAQs and Troubleshooting

  • Why did my crust turn out too hard? It could be due to overmixing or overbaking. Make sure to mix gently and check on your crust a few minutes before the recommended baking time!

  • Can I make this ahead of time? Absolutely! You can prepare the crust and cream cheese layer a day in advance. Just assemble it with the fruits when you’re ready to serve.

  • What fruits work best? Really, any fruit works! However, softer fruits like bananas can brown quickly, so I recommend adding those right before serving.

  • How do I prevent the fruits from sliding off? Make sure your cream cheese layer is well-spread and chilled before adding the fruit. This will help ‘glue’ them in place!
